This patent protects the core logic for ensuring program launch integrity in terminal devices, specifically controlling program activation based on specific service names even when multiple broadcasters share identical resource IDs. It is a robust right, having been granted after rigorous examination and demonstrating clear differentiation from three cited prior art documents, offering a strong market advantage.
This patent primarily covers program launch integrity. White space exists in developing advanced user interface personalization algorithms or optimizing content delivery network routing based on real-time service context, which are not directly claimed here.
